Prusa MK4 or Bambu labs p1s

Hi there,

I'm considering upgrading my old ender 3 and it looks like the prusa MK4 or bambu labs p1s are the current best options out there.

I like the bambu labs for the fast print speed and x/y print bed. I also love the idea of the AMS - it would be awesome to print in colour! But being closed source puts me off a bit as I currently use octopeint and obico to monitor my ender 3 which, as far as I can tell, Is not possible to use with bambu labs. Also having to upload gcode to the cloud is not ideal.

The prusa however is great because of the open source nature. However the slinger bed and slower prints are putting me off. I have also read that the mmu can be temperamental at best, so printing colour may not be an option?

Any thoughts/recommendations?

Help with selfhosted wireguard routed through gluetun

Hi there,

I wish to run a wireguard docker through a glueton docker so that i can access my paid vpn from my own server. This is what i want:

client -> wireguard docker(selfhosted) -> gluetun docker(connected to paid VPN) -> internet

I have posted before with this issue but still cannot get it to work as expected. I am not sure if there is issues with the wireguard docker not being able to route back through from gluetun as it is trying to force traffic through the tunnel.

Any help would be much appreciated.

docker-compose.yml: ``` services: gluetun_test: image: qmcgaw/gluetun container_name: gluetun_test cap_add: - NET_ADMIN ports: - "5010:5000" - "5011:8000" # Port of the WireGuard VPN server - "36843:36843/udp" environment: - VPN_SERVICE_PROVIDER=custom - VPN_TYPE=wireguard - WIREGUARD_PUBLIC_KEY= - WIREGUARD_PRIVATE_KEY= - VPN_ENDPOINT_IP=ip - VPN_ENDPOINT_PORT=port - WIREGUARD_ADDRESSES="10.2.0.2/32"

wireguard: image: linuxserver/wireguard:latest container_name: wireguard cap_add: - NET_ADMIN environment: - PUID=1000 - PGID=1000 volumes: - ./wireguard/config:/config

ports:

# Port for WireGuard-UI

- "5010:5000"

# Port of the WireGuard VPN server

- "36843:36843/udp"

network_mode: service:gluetun_test sysctls: - net.ipv4.conf.all.src_valid_mark=1 ```

wg0.conf ```

Address updated at: 2023-07-08 18:51:31.120262753 +0000 UTC

Private Key updated at: 2023-05-09 18:59:02.233090133 +0000 UTC

[Interface] Address = 10.252.1.0/24 ListenPort = 36843 PrivateKey = MTU = 1450 PostUp = iptables -A FORWARD -i wg0 -j ACCEPT; iptables -t nat -A POSTROUTING -o eth0 -j MASQUERADE PostDown = iptables -D FORWARD -i wg0 -j ACCEPT; iptables -t nat -D POSTROUTING -o eth0 -j MASQUERADE Table =

[Peer] PublicKey = PresharedKey = AllowedIPs = 10.252.1.1/24 ```
